I used a flat-blade screwdriver up through the bottom to "pop" the shelf cover (partially) off. I then fed the USB cable up through the shelf and slid it through the slot in the cover. Then I pushed the cover back down and clicked it into place. :)

I pulled up the right side of the rubber charging mat whilst sat in the showroom Trophy demo car… there’s just a couple of rubber plugs holding it down as far as I could see. Just takes a bit of a yank to get it up, went back down fine.
The hole to get the cable up from below is plenty big enough, its just that the slit on the rubber top mat is much tighter to locate the cable once it’s through.
